BIOGRAPHY – Dr. GEORGIOS GKOUDELIS (GOUDELIS)

George D. Goudelis, was born in Köln, Germany. He completed his education in Thessaloniki, Greece and graduated from the Medical school of Aristotle University and physical therapy school, Thessaloniki, Greece.

Dr. Goudelis completed his Orthopaedic residency at University of Athens, Orthopedic and Trauma KAT Hospital, under the director, Professor PN. Soucacos. During his five year residency he received special training in hip and knee arthroplasties, fractures and trauma surgery, knee arthroscopy, Orthopaedic Sports Medicine surgery, microsurgery and at the Children's General Hospital Penteli Athens training in Pediatric Orthopaedics.

Following his residency, Dr. Goudelis  received fellowship training, with a scholarship, at the  Ruprecht-Karls University of Heidelberg, “Center of Knee, Foot, Ankle and Orthopaedic Sports Medicine Surgery"  in the world famous Clinic ATOS , HEIDELBERG GERMANY”, an approved training Center  of ISAKOS (International Society of Arthroscopy Knee Surgery & Orthopaedic Sports Medicine). 

While at ATOS, under the supervision of Orthopaedic professors, Dr. Hans Paessler and Hayo Thermann, Dr. Gkoudelis received intensive training in advanced arthroscopic and reconstructive knee surgery and sports medicine; Knee arthroplasty MIS-unicondylar Knee arthroplasty, meniscal and chondrocyte transplantation, and regenerative medicine of the joints.

At the end of his scholarship year he remained in the clinic ATOS at the shoulder and elbow surgery Clinic under the directorship of Professor P. Habermayer and took part specialized surgeries. (Arthroscopies and arthroplasties).

Upon his return to Greece, in 2007, he was awarded his doctorate for the title of PhD from the University of Athens.

In 2020, after intensive training at the ZIMMER BIOMET INSTITUTE in Germany, in robotic knee surgery, he received international certification and is considered one of the few officially recognized orthopedic specialists trained in ROSA robotic arthroplasty in Europe. In 2022 Dr. Georgios Gkoudelis is founder member of European Hip Preservation Associates EHPA - ESSKA.

Throughout his career, Dr. Goudelis has been a guest speaker at numerous conferences and seminars, has taken part in organizing educational lessons of the University of Athens, has published articles in  both National and International  peer reviewed journals, as well as  several chapters in Greek Orthopaedic medical textbooks.

Dr. Goudelis continues to be associated with the ATOS CLINIC in Heidelberg for continuing his training in evolving developments in Orthopaedic surgery and he is a current member of European Society of Sports Traumatology, Knee Surgery and Arthroscopy (ESSKA).

For the last 15 years he has been intensively engaged in reconstructive and Patient Specific knee arthroplasties and hip arthroplasties and has performed most of the personalized PSI knee arthroplasty surgeries in Greece, as well as the most ALMIS minimally invasive hip arthroplasties surgery in Northern Greece with great success and international recognition.

Today, the Orthopedic Surgeon George Goudelis lives in Thessaloniki and is the founder and scientific director of the ArthroHeal Clinic Orthopedic Medical Center - Special center for Robotic and Personalized Orthopedic Surgery and Biological Applications - in Kalamaria.
